FRPP gears actually made by motive
Hey, I just had my 4.10s put in( love them by the way, in a 3650 its perfect)
Anyways, the guy at the shop said that certain part # FRPP gears are actually made by motive gear.
He says on an actual ford gear there will be a part # stamped at the end of the pinion, on a motive made ford gear there will be numbers engraved on the pinion gear, along with the Ford Racing emblem engraved on the Ring gear.
I got mine from 50resto.com
When looking at certain gears he had there, what he said seemed to be true, there are boxes that also differ. One box style has a picture of a red 94-98 packing the front wheels. and says Ford Racing on the box. The other style box's simply just have a picture of a ring and pinion and say Ring and Pinion set, and something about Factory parts that win...
Anything to this? Conspiracy maybe....

RE: FRPP gears actually made by motive
Yeah, I did a search before I bought my 4.10's and Ford uses 2 suppliers, Motive being one. I have a touch of whine between 40 and 50 MPH but not enough to even mention. The radio on low volume drowns it out. I had 3.73's put into an '82 Vette that came with 2.72's and an OD automatic that in OD had a 1.90 ratio, great for cruising but terrible for speed quick and they had a whistle like the Motives I have and they never gave me trouble. As was said a good installer will get them in without excessive whine. mark
